There are design limits for all of the above that may vary between different processes, but any of the above could be the limitation to a kiln's output. These limitations will typically manifest them-selves as kiln instability and ring or coating buildup,excessive dust loss, poor refractory life, poor clinker quality, or high fuel consumption.

W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Coatings and blockages can often occur in the cyclone preheaters of rotary kiln plants for burning cement clinker. They result from the combined action of recirculating materials (alkalis, chlorides, sulfates), intermediate compounds from the decomposition of raw meal that have a tendency to stick together, and an extremely high dust loading in ...

WhatsApp: +86 18221755073The inside of a cement kiln is an extremely challenging environment for making any kind of temperature measurement. Kiln rotation, high temperatures, and the movement of the sintering material along the kiln, make thermocouples and other contact-based temperature sensors impractical.
